Service Officer:
The VA has recently approved a list of Blue Water
ships for the Brown Water service such as LST's,
Destroyers, etc. If you have submitted a claim to
the VA from an Agent Orange related disability or
are a former "Frogman" and was denied, get down to
the Veterans Service Office. You may be able to
resubmit the claim and secure the benefits you're
entitled to OR that a survivor/dependent is entitled
to.
